Finding early-stage digital asset projects can be an exciting opportunity for those looking to explore innovative modern technology and potential future leaders in the blockchain space. Presales, often taking place before a project is formally introduced to the general public, offer access to new tokens at an introductory price. These opportunities can stand out from those that carefully comply with emerging tech growths and decentralized ecosystems. Among the crucial advantages of participating in a presale is the potential to access tokens before they are listed on significant systems, where costs may enhance due to wider direct exposure and need. However, not every project is built to last, and mindful factor to consider is needed before choosing where to allot funds.
The most effective presales usually belong to projects with a clear roadmap, transparent team, strong utility, and energetic community. Utility describes how the token will certainly be utilized within its environment. For instance, some tokens offer access to services or products, administration legal rights, rewards, or cost discount rates. A strong use instance boosts the long-term potential of the project. The team behind the project should also be visible and seasoned. Designers with a proven record of providing on guarantees, coupled with open communication channels, are usually liked. Anonymous groups with little to no history can posture a greater risk.
Presales can also obtain momentum through community passion. Systems like Discord, X, Telegram, and forums often organize dynamic discussions regarding upcoming projects. A strong community can add to the project's exposure and credibility. It also shows that individuals believe in the vision and agree to participate proactively in its development. If a project gains quick traction online, it can be an excellent sign of strong future adoption. Still, one must stay cautious of hype-driven projects that do not offer sufficient substance beyond showy advertising.
Smart contract safety is another crucial variable. When engaging with presale opportunities, it's important to confirm if the project has been investigated by a reliable 3rd party. Audits help to ensure that the underlying code is safe and doesn't consist of hidden vulnerabilities or technicalities. Without an audit, even a promising project might suffer technical failings, breaches, or loss of funds. Transparent projects often present audit results publicly and upgrade them routinely as the project expands.

Involvement in a presale usually calls for adhering to certain actions detailed by the project. This may consist of joining through an official platform, using a compatible digital purse, and completing verification procedures. Each presale may have its own collection of policies, consisting of minimum or optimum payment restrictions, vesting durations, and qualification standards. Reviewing these information meticulously aids avoid misconceptions or unanticipated restrictions.
